Output 384a170cc04287abdbc598dbade22019fe05419fc7965146706dba8935697b39:0

value
303239
script pubkey
OP_0 OP_PUSHBYTES_20 efd27ce70165507a015d3eb4068f7a3cf79ab876
address
bc1qalf8eecpv4g85q2a866qdrm68nme4wrk3ju7cc
transaction
384a170cc04287abdbc598dbade22019fe05419fc7965146706dba8935697b39
confirmations
261359
spent
true